What is Greek vinaigrette made of?
This Greek vinaigrette is made simply with olive oil, red wine vinegar, fresh garlic, dried oregano and salt and pepper. We’ll add a touch of honey or maple syrup to balance the flavors. That’s it!

What is balsamic vinaigrette dressing made of?
Balsamic Vinaigrette Recipe Ingredients
Balsamic vinegar – It fills the dressing with bold, sweet, and tangy flavor. Extra-virgin olive oil – It gives the dressing body and richness. Dijon mustard – For extra tang. Honey or maple syrup – It mellows the acidity of the mustard and balsamic.

How long does homemade Greek dressing last in the fridge?
We recommend consuming dressings and sauces within 3-4 days to be safe. Food safety aside, we tend to prefer the taste of freshly made dressings, especially when using citrus, yogurt or garlic, and find that 3-4 days is the sweet spot.

What’s the difference between balsamic vinegar and balsamic vinaigrette?
Balsamic vinegar is just vinegar (grape must), whereas a balsamic vinaigrette is made by combining balsamic vinegar with oil, sugar and other seasonings. In general, if you’re looking for a super healthy option for salad dressing, you can stick to just oil and vinegar, which won’t have any added sugar or salt!
Is vinaigrette the same as balsamic vinegar?
Balsamic vinaigrette is simply a vinaigrette made with balsamic vinegar. Vinaigrette is a concoction that contains a variety of ingredients like vinegar, sugar, oil. It can also involve seasonings like garlic powder, salt, and pepper. In brief, balsamic vinegar is the base in balsamic vinaigrette.

How do you thicken Greek dressing?
The best ways to thicken homemade salad dressings are by adding:
- Cornstarch or other thickeners.
- Seeds such as flax or chia seeds.
- Solid ingredients like chopped fruit or vegetables.
- Emulsifiers such as prepared mustard, toasted garlic, tahini.
- Dairy.
- Gelling agents.
- Xanthan gum or guar gum.
How do you make a yogurt salad sauce?
Creamy Lemon Yogurt Salad Dressing:
- ▢ 1/2 cup plain yogurt , preferably Greek.
- 1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il.
- 2 1/2 tbsp lemon juice.
- 1 tsp garlic , minced.
- 1 1/2 tsp sugar.
- 1/4 tsp black pepper.
- 1/2 tsp salt.
Can you add vinegar to yogurt?
Dressing up
For the base, blend a half cup of Greek yogurt with a tablespoon of good olive oil. Add a couple tablespoons of vinegar like rice vinegar, red wine vinegar, or apple cider vinegar, plus some salt and pepper to taste. You may also want to sweeten it a tad with a bit of honey, stevia, or maple syrup.
